Understanding Frigidaire Refrigerator Shelf Types

Frigidaire uses different shelf designs for their refrigerators. Knowing which type you have helps you adjust them safely and efficiently.

Glass Shelves

Most new Frigidaire models use tempered glass shelves. These are strong but can crack if handled roughly. The shelves usually have plastic or metal trim, and they rest on tracks molded into the sides of the fridge.

Wire Shelves

Some budget or older models use wire shelves. These are lighter and easier to remove. Wire shelves often sit on small pegs or clips and can be lifted straight out.

Cantilever Shelves

High-end models may feature cantilever shelves. These don’t sit on side supports but instead lock into slots on the fridge wall, giving a “floating” appearance. Adjusting these often requires a different technique than standard shelves.

Door Bins And Drawers

While not the main focus here, door bins and crisper drawers can usually be adjusted as well. Door bins typically slide up and out, while crisper drawers are removed by tilting and lifting.

Knowing your shelf type helps prevent breakage and makes the adjustment process smoother.

Step-by-step Guide: How To Adjust Frigidaire Refrigerator Shelves

Let’s walk through the process for each main shelf type. The steps are similar, but small details matter.

Adjusting Glass Shelves

1. Open The Fridge Door Fully

Open the door wide enough so you have space to tilt and remove the shelf.

2. Remove The Shelf

Hold the shelf with both hands. Lift the front edge slightly, then pull forward. If the shelf feels stuck, check for retaining tabs or stops at the back or sides. Gently wiggle to release, but do not force.

3. Clean If Needed

Once removed, wipe the shelf and the shelf tracks with a damp cloth.

4. Choose New Position

Look for a row of notches or molded tracks on the side walls. Decide which level suits your storage needs.

5. Insert The Shelf

Tilt the shelf slightly and align the back corners with the desired tracks. Slide back until the shelf is level and sits firmly. Push gently to make sure it’s secure.

6. Double-check Stability

Before loading food back, press down gently to ensure the shelf is locked in place.

Tip: Always support the glass fully with both hands. Never let the shelf hang by one side, as this can cause cracks.

Adjusting Wire Shelves

1. Remove Items

Take all items off the shelf.

2. Release Shelf From Pegs Or Clips

Lift the front of the shelf. Some models require you to push the shelf slightly back before lifting.

3. Slide Out The Shelf

Pull the shelf out carefully. If there are stoppers, tilt the shelf to free it.

4. Select New Height

Find the next set of pegs or holes that will hold the shelf at your desired height.

5. Install The Shelf

Insert the back of the shelf into the holes or onto the pegs, then lower the front until it rests securely.

6. Test For Stability

Gently press on the shelf to ensure it won’t tip or slide.

Insight: Many people forget that pegs and slots may be hidden behind plastic covers. If you can’t find more holes, look for covers that pop out.

Adjusting Cantilever Shelves

1. Empty The Shelf

Remove all food items.

2. Lift Up And Out

Cantilever shelves usually need to be lifted straight up at a slight angle. This unlocks the hooks from the slots.

3. Slide Forward

Once unlocked, pull the shelf toward you.

4. Choose Slot Position

Look for vertical slots along the fridge wall. Pick the height you want.

5. Insert And Lock

Align the shelf’s hooks with the new slots. Insert and lower the shelf until it clicks into place.

6. Check Security

Ensure the shelf is locked and cannot be pulled out without lifting.

Non-obvious tip: Some cantilever shelves have a small latch or tab you must press before lifting. Always check your manual or inspect the shelf closely.

Adjusting Door Bins And Crisper Drawers

Even though the main focus is the shelves, many people also want to move door bins or drawers. Here’s how:

  • Door Bins: Lift up and pull out. To replace, align with the guides and slide down until it locks.
  • Crisper Drawers: Pull out until it stops, then lift the front and pull out fully. To replace, tilt slightly and push back into the rails.

Don’t force these parts—they are often made of brittle plastic.

Common Mistakes To Avoid

Even though adjusting shelves seems simple, some mistakes can cause real problems. Here are the top errors—and how to avoid them.

1. Forcing Shelves

Never use too much force. If a shelf won’t move, check for tabs, stops, or ice build-up.

2. Mixing Shelf Types

Don’t put a glass shelf on wire supports, or vice versa. Each shelf type is designed for specific supports.

3. Overloading Shelves

After adjustment, check the weight limit (usually listed in your manual). Overloading can cause glass shelves to crack.

4. Not Leveling Shelves

If a shelf is crooked, it may slide or fall. Always make sure both sides are inserted at the same height.

5. Ignoring Airflow

Don’t block the air vents with a shelf or large item. This reduces cooling efficiency and can spoil food.

6. Losing Shelf Parts

Keep all clips, pegs, and covers in a safe place during adjustments.

Advanced Insight: Shelves often have a small “lip” at the edge to catch spills. Make sure this lip faces forward—otherwise, liquids can drip into the rest of the fridge.

Cleaning And Maintaining Shelves

While the shelves are out, it’s the perfect time to clean your fridge.

  • Glass Shelves: Wash with warm, soapy water. Dry fully before replacing.
  • Wire Shelves: Wipe with a damp cloth or run under warm water. Check for rust spots.
  • Plastic Trims: Use mild cleaner; harsh chemicals can cause cracks.

Never put cold glass shelves in hot water—they can shatter from temperature shock. Let shelves warm to room temperature first.

Troubleshooting Shelf Issues

What if you run into problems? Here are some common shelf adjustment issues and solutions.

Shelf Won’t Move

  • Check for ice build-up or sticky spills
  • Look for locking tabs or buttons
  • Let the fridge warm up a bit, as cold plastic can stick

Shelf Is Loose Or Wobbly

  • Make sure both sides are in the same slot or peg
  • Check for broken supports or missing clips

Shelf Is Stuck

  • Gently wiggle side-to-side while pulling
  • Don’t use tools that can crack plastic or glass

Can’t Find Extra Slots

  • Look behind plastic covers or trims
  • Check the manual for “hidden” adjustment features

Shelf Broke During Adjustment

  • Order a replacement from the Frigidaire parts website or an authorized dealer
  • Always match the part number to your fridge model

Frequently Asked Questions

What Is The Weight Limit For Frigidaire Refrigerator Shelves?

Most glass shelves can hold between 20–30 pounds, while wire shelves may hold a bit more. Always check your manual for the exact weight limit, as overloading can cause cracks or bends.

Can I Adjust Shelves While The Fridge Is Running?

Yes, but it’s safer and easier to adjust shelves after emptying them. For major adjustments or cleaning, unplugging the fridge is recommended but not required.

Why Won’t My Shelf Fit Back Into The Same Spot?

Check that both sides are lined up with the tracks or pegs. If the shelf is tilted or one side is higher, it may not slide in. Remove and try again, making sure both ends are level.

Are All Frigidaire Shelves Interchangeable?

No. Shelves are designed for specific models and support types. Glass and wire shelves are not usually interchangeable. Always use shelves made for your fridge model.
